Default Data filter and deleting rows in visual basic

Hello,
In my excel file I would like to filter collumn C,D and G for particular
criteria by using a macro code in visual basic. This macro code should also
delete the rows that did not pass the filter. This can't be done with the
autofilter function, because I would like to use the filtered data for
making a pivottable and graphs (by using autofilter function all data is used
for making a pivottable+graphs, also the data that did not pass the filter).
So I need a code that filters the data for row C,D and G (each has another
criteria) for a specific criteria, and also deletes the rows that did not
pass the filter. It would be great if someone could help me!
